Output 05093d09b4e6c42a430895f9261c16103f77f4f5aa1592b5feade99f5d7e9449:7

value
22359551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3850c8ee329dbf27f9f8d3db81884fc923da09a9 OP_EQUAL
address
MD2vrCqTf2pFdXSh2HrbtKoJYNpMi1ytmG
transaction
05093d09b4e6c42a430895f9261c16103f77f4f5aa1592b5feade99f5d7e9449
spent
true